In the Bruceville and greater Knox County area, professional cabinet installation typically ranges from $1,500 to $5,000+, heavily dependent on project scope. Key cost factors include the complexity of the layout (e.g., custom angles in older homes), the cabinet type (stock vs. custom), and whether old cabinets need removal. Local material and labor costs are generally moderate but can be affected by seasonal demand, with summer being a peak period.
For an average-sized kitchen in a Bruceville home, professional installation usually takes 2 to 5 days. This timeline includes careful removal of old cabinets (if needed), precise leveling and securing of new units—a critical step in older homes with potentially uneven floors—and final hardware attachment. Delays can occur if subfloor repairs are needed or if custom items require adjustments, so it's wise to plan for some flexibility.
While cabinet installation itself rarely requires a specific permit in Bruceville, any associated electrical or plumbing work (like moving outlets or sinks) likely will. It's crucial to check with the **Knox County Building Department** for local codes, especially regarding structural changes to load-bearing walls. Furthermore, if your home is in a historic district, there may be aesthetic guidelines to follow.

Look for companies experienced with our regional climate, as Indiana's humidity swings can cause wood to expand and contract, requiring proper installation techniques to prevent future warping or gap issues.
Indiana's significant humidity changes, with hot, humid summers and dry winters, can cause solid wood cabinets to slightly expand and contract. This can sometimes lead to minor door sticking or gap variations. A professional installer in Bruceville will acclimate cabinets to your home's environment before installation and ensure proper sealing and finishing to mitigate these effects, ensuring long-term durability.
